Biblical Meaning of Names

Meaning of the name Liora (General and Biblical)

The name Liora is of Hebrew origin and means “light” or “my light” in general. In the Bible, Liora is a variant of the name Lior, which means “I have light” or “I am light.” It is a beautiful and meaningful name that symbolizes brightness, illumination, and positivity.

In the Bible, the name Liora is not explicitly mentioned. However, the concept of light is a recurring theme throughout the scriptures. In the book of Genesis, God creates light on the first day of creation, separating it from the darkness. This act of creation symbolizes the triumph of light over darkness, good over evil.

Throughout the Bible, light is often associated with God’s presence, truth, and righteousness. In the book of Psalms, King David writes, “The Lord is my light and my salvation—whom shall I fear?” This verse highlights the idea that God’s light guides and protects us, leading us out of darkness and into the light.

In Jewish culture, the name Liora is sometimes given to girls born during the festival of Hanukkah, which celebrates the miracle of light. This holiday commemorates the rededication of the Holy Temple in Jerusalem and the miraculous burning of the menorah for eight days with only a small amount of oil. The name Liora is a fitting choice for girls born during this time, symbolizing the light that shines brightly even in the face of darkness.
